The Virden Donor's Choice is a public foundation based in Virden, Manitoba, classified by the CRA under foundations. In its fiscal year ending October 31, 2024, it reported $65K in revenue and $55K in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 98% from donations. In 2024,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$96.

Compared with 3,025 grantmaking char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 80% of peers.

As a grantmaker, it reported gifts to 19 qualified donees totalling $54K in 2024, the largest being $8,169 to Canadian Cancer Society. Revenue has grown substantially over its filings on record here, from $19K in 2020 to $65K in 2024.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 3 names.
